#59d453 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#59d453 is composed of 34.9% red, 83.1% green and 32.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58% cyan, 0% magenta, 60.8%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 117.2 degrees, a saturation of 60% and a lightness of 57.8%. #59d453 color hex could be obtained by blending #b2ffa6 with #00a900.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

#59d453 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#59d453 has RGB values of R:89, G:212, B:83 and CMYK values of C:0.58, M:0, Y:0.61,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 5887059.
